Molecular lever that regulates neuron signaling may guide treatments for epilepsy, pain and Alzheimer's disease

Neurons transmit information to the next cell by converting electrical signals into chemical signals. A critical step in this process is the influx of calcium ions into the cell through voltage-gated calcium channels. A research team led by Professor Byung Chang Suh of the Department of Brain Sciences has, for the first time, uncovered a molecular mechanism that regulates the N-type voltage-gated calcium channel (CaV2.2), which plays a critical role in neural signal transmission.
